A help-seeking resource for students created by ThriveSMH, our provincial student reference group. The aim of this resource is to support help-seeking in young people by providing information on the following:   Throughout the resource, you will also find positive affirmations and reminders there is help around and no problem is #TooBigOrTooSmall to reach out and ask for help.
